    There is a lot to like about this 1821 JR-8 dime. It has beautifully (re)toned and has great eye appeal. But, there appears to be more wear than is appropriate for an AU-55. Yes, there are some elements of weak strike but there is apparent not-insignificant wear on both obverse and reverse. The JR-8 is the only use of these obverse and reverse dies so they should not have been worn down or lapped.

    I'll admit to being torn on whether it got a bean. On the one hand, I think it is market over-graded. OTOH, I think CAC could easily have given it the benefit of the doubt due to its toning and general eye appeal.

    So, in the end I'll say it got the bean. Why didn't I just say that to begin with?
